The Link-Belt RTC-8090 Series II is a rough terrain crane, built for remarkable control, reliability, and capacity performance on any terrain. Powered by a hydraulic system for greater productivity and control, the five-pump hydraulic circuit allows simultaneous function of boom hoist, winch and swing to maximize efficiency.

The RTC-8090 Series II has a max. lifting capacity of 80 metric tons (90 U.S. tons). The max. length for the full power latching boom is 42.7 (140 ft), comprised of five sections, with quick reeve boom head and 3 extend modes. Optional extensions are possible upon inquiry. The max. tip height is 72.5 m (238 ft).
